... among boys’ lacrosse players. Purpose: To characterize verified game-related impacts, both overall and those directly to the head, in boys’ varsity high school lacrosse. Study Design: Cross-sectional study; Level of evidence, 3. Methods: A total of 77 male participants (mean age, 16.6 ± 1.2 years; mean height, 1.77 ± 0.05 m; mean weight, 73.4 ± 12.2 kg) were instrumented with sensors and were videotaped during 39 games. We have studied the centrality dependence of charged-particle forward-backward multiplicity correlation strength in Au$+$Au collisions at $\sqrt{{s}_{\mathit{NN}}}=200$ GeV with a parton and hadron cascade model, PACIAE, based on PYTHIA. The calculated results are compared with the STAR data. The experimentally observed correlation strength characteristics, ($1$) the approximately flat pseudorapidity dependence in central collisions and ($2$) the monotonous decrease with decreasing centrality, are reproduced ...

A three dimensional finite element computer simulation has been performed to assess the effects of release waves in normal impact soft-recovery experiments when a star-shaped flyer plate is used. Their effects on the monitored velocity-time profiles have been identified and their implications in the interpretation of wave spreading and spall signal events highlighted. The calculation shows that the star-shaped flyer plate indeed minimizes the magnitude of edge effects. The major perturbation to ...

Broken thin brittle plates like windows and windshields are ubiquitous in our environment. When impacted locally, they typically present a pattern of cracks extending radially outward from the impact point. We study the variation of the pattern of cracks by performing controlled transverse impacts on brittle plates over a broad range of impact speed, plate thickness, and material properties, and we establish from experiments a global scaling law for the number of radial cracks incorporating all ...

The increasing acceptance of the efficacy and validity of applied games, and specifically games for health, has fostered the growth of new ideas and applications. Engineers and game developers are working on a range of products that integrate new electronics that can detect physiological states with game or game-like interfaces. These devices can record and transmit physical and behavioral data as well as motivate participants to modify behavior in prosocial and prohealth ways. The U.S. and European ...

Prepartying and drinking game playing are associated with excessive alcohol consumption and alcohol-related negative consequences in college populations; however, research exploring the prevalence of these high risk drinking contexts among high school students, and how such engagement may impact both high school and subsequent college drinking risk, is lacking. The current study, which is the first study to assess prepartying during high school, examined how engaging in either prepartying or drinking game playing during high school was associated with risky ...
